とするターボチヤージヤ。 A turbocharger in which a rotating shaft having a turbine wheel at one end is rotatably supported, and the turbine wheel is housed in a turbine housing, wherein the turbine wheel is connected to a scroll winding start part of the turbine housing from an end of the scroll winding start part. A turbocharger characterized by having a slit extending in the circumferential direction.
